Why do we always accuse the airlines of lying?

Yes, I have been told wrong information to my face.
Yes, I have been told "gate one," when it is really gate 49. Yes, I have been told that my special meal is on board when it is not. Yes, I have been told they would hold the plane for my connecting flight, but they don't. Yes, I have been told that the flight is delayed due to ATC, when it is really because of crew shortage.

But I have found through all this that it is only on VERY rare ocassion that an agent purposefully lies. They should have better information, but unfortunately they don't. So we often complain that they are lying, when in truth, they just are in the dark.
